James T. Voyvodic is an Associate Professor in the Department of Radiology and an Associate Research Professor in Neurobiology at Duke University. He is a Core Faculty member of the Center for Brain Imaging and Analysis. His research focuses on neuroimaging techniques applied to neurological and psychiatric disorders, with a particular emphasis on pediatric epilepsy, schizophrenia, functional MRI (fMRI), and neurodevelopmental studies. His work integrates clinical and experimental approaches to understand brain connectivity and pathophysiological mechanisms.
Education:
- Ph.D. in Neuroscience, Washington University in St. Louis (1988)
- B.S. in Biology, Yale University (1976)
Research Interests: Dr. Voyvodic’s expertise spans neuroimaging methodologies, including resting-state fMRI and task-based paradigms, to study disorders such as epilepsy, schizophrenia, and alcohol-related neurodevelopmental disruptions. He investigates brain network dynamics, synaptic development in autonomic systems, and the impact of interventions like repetitive transcranial magnetic stimulation (rTMS) on motor networks in dystonia. His work also explores translational applications in clinical neurology and psychiatry.
